Team Lead (Cannabis)

Our Team Leads provide best-in-class customer engagement and drive sales.

You will be an important influence in driving the store’s profitability by guiding our team members in delivering a positive and friendly experience by engaging our customers through thoughtful conversation and exceptional service.

As Team Lead, you will adhere to and enforce all compliance regulations governing the purchasing and selling of Cannabis and Non-Cannabis products and oversee all facets of policy and procedures and operational administrative duties in relation to the store.

Our Team Leads model the way by leading and inspiring the team.

They train and develop the team in core competencies of service and product knowledge.

You will assume the role of peer mentor in-store with regards to talent development and employee mentorship.

Additional Responsibilities:
Partner with store leadership to educate and communicate hourly and daily goals to drive sales.
Support the development of team members with an aptitude or interest in store leadership to ensure bench strength and succession planning.
Participate in daily department and store meetings and communicate store and company information and directives to the team.
Train in Loss Prevention awareness and oversee the adherence to Loss Prevention practices.
Collaborate with General Manager and Store Leadership to enhance the store environment and efficiently execute all inventory and merchandising tasks; ensure fast and efficient flow of merchandise to the sales floor.
Upholds excellent customer service and a service-orientated culture.
Ensure compliance with all BCC, State and City regulations.

Ensure compliance with company emergency and safety procedures to protect employees and customers from accidents and incidents.

Qualifications Include:
Must have a minimum of 2-years’ experience in Management in a retail environment.
B.A.

preferred, but experience is paramount.
Must pass a federal background check via Live Scan.
Must be 21+ years old.
Experience working in a highly regulated businesses is desirable.
Ability to exhibit consistent professional communication, follow through and problem-solving skills while maintaining a global view of Store operations; use sound judgment when making decisions.
Willingness to grow as a Lead by going beyond assigned department tasks to take on additional responsibilities.
Exhibits strong leadership skills amongst peers and have confidence communicating at the store level.
Previous retail experience preferred.
Previous Cannabis experience preferred.
This position regularly requires working mornings, nights, weekends, and holidays.
